This image captures a vibrant cultural event taking place on a street in Yucay, Peru. A long line of young women and girls, primarily adolescents, are performing a traditional dance or participating in a parade. They are dressed in elaborate and colorful costumes, consisting of bright red long-sleeved blouses, and voluminous layered skirts with intricate, multi-colored patterns, predominantly featuring black, red, yellow, and green hues. Each dancer is adorned with a thick, rainbow-colored yarn garland draped around their neck and over one shoulder, adding to the festive appearance. Their footwear includes decorative, multi-strapped sandals. Many of the dancers are smiling broadly, conveying a sense of joy, energy, and pride in their performance. They appear to be moving in unison down a paved street, which has a concrete sidewalk or curb visible on the right. In the background, modest multi-story buildings with reddish-brown tiled roofs line the street, characteristic of Andean towns. On the left side of the frame, a large, translucent or white canopy structure is visible, suggesting an outdoor event or market area. Faint colorful decorations can be seen hanging under this structure. An observer, dressed in a light green jacket, light blue top, and grey pants, stands on the sidewalk, watching the dancers. The scene is brightly illuminated by natural daylight, indicating clear weather. A small piece of white litter is visible on the street near one of the dancers' feet. No text is visible in the image.
